TRAINING PACKAGE FOR PSYCHOLOGY SUPERVISORS A COMPETENCY-BASED INITIATIVE WITH FLEXIBLE DELIVERY COMPONENTS

Overview 1) Introduction and background 2) Project objectives 3) Project activities 4) Project achievements 5) Pending issues and way forward Acknowledgements

1. Background Recent changes by PsyBA requiring accreditation of supervisors for Psychology New accreditation requirements come into effect in July 2013 Current supervisors: Transition requirements ( before June 30, 2013 ) New supervisors: New requirements for all applications in July 2013

1. Background Possible impact Fewer accredited supervisors => reduced training capacity Urgent need for development of supervisor training resources, across university sectors Current supervisors who did not have supervisor accreditation to meet transition requirements by PsyBA Development of supervisor training resources for training workshops after July 2013

2. Objectives for project 2.1 To design training resources that will meet Psychologists Board of Australia requirements for supervisor accreditation Global objective: Comprehensive, 8 training modules, involvement of 4 ICTNs ( South Coast, Sydney, Metro North and East, and the Hunter ICTNs) Specific objective: South coast ICTN, preparation of 2 modules

2. Objectives for project 2.2 To up-skill current supervisors to enable them to meet transition requirements for supervisor accreditation

3. Project activities & tasks Four Main tasks: 3.1 Online platform to deliver teaching materials 3.2 Preparation of teaching content for 2 modules 3.3 Preparation of video clips 3.4 Conducting pilot supervisor workshops and evaluating these

2.3 Project modules 8 Modules: 2 modules X 4 ICTNs 1) Competency-based models of supervision: principles and applications to supervisory practice 2) Establishing SMART goals in supervision: a competency-based approach 3) Supervising for the development of competencies in working with difference. 4) Understanding your development and role as a supervisor

2.3 Project modules 5) Supervising for the development of case- conceptualisation competencies 6) Supervising to enhance metacompetencies in supervisee: Reflective Practice and scientist-practitioner attitudes 7) Supervising for the development of competencies in ethical and professional practice 8) Summative assessment issues and specific assessment difficulties (impairment and underperforming supervisees) in supervision

4.1 Achievements: Online platform Choice of Moodle as appropriate platform Versatile, can handle assessment material Recruited IT support Established a site licence and portal for the 8 modules (4 courses) du.au Uploaded content Needs final refinements

4.2 Achievements Preparation of teaching content Content for two modules were required Preliminary work done previously Revisions and updating Assessment material Assessment tasks formulated Requires evaluation and finalisation

4.3 Achievements Preparation of video clips Required scripting, role plays, feedback, recording, editing => final copy, packaging Four of 6 clips have been finalised and recorded in studio Fifth clip: preliminary version has been recorded. Studio recording is pending

4.4 Achievements: Supervisor workshops Liaised with Associate Professor Vida Bliokas, (Principal Psychologist, Illawarra & Shoalhaven Local Health District ) & David Hedger (Drug & Alcohol Services ) Identified target group for workshops Current supervisors who were yet to obtain supervisor accreditation Conducted supervisor training workshops on May 22 nd (N=33) and May 29 th (N=30)

5. Pending issues and way forward Content for modules Assessment tasks to be finalised Examine online platform for delivery and archiving Video clips Graphics for DVD and cover Record video scenario 5 in studio

5. Pending issues and way forward Collaborate with other ICTNs to ensure training package meets Psychologists Board of Australia (PsyBA) Delayed guidelines from PsyBA
